[DatePublished] => 2010-08-26 00:00:00 [ColumnID] => 133272 [Focus] => 0 [AuthorID] => [AuthorName] => [SectionName] => Science and Environment [SectionUrl] => science-and-environment [URL] => ) [3] => Array ( [ArticleID] => 325102 [Title] => 2006 Epilepsy Exemplar Awards launched [Summary] => The Philippine League Against Epilepsy (PLAE), in cooperation with Abbott Laboratories, has launched a nationwide search for the 2006 Epilepsy Exemplar Awards. 

Four winners – two adults and two children – will be given the awards this year. They will receive cash prizes, trophies and the opportunity to be PLAE Ambassadors of Epilepsy.

Each nominee must be a Filipino citizen, eight to 65 years old, diagnosed to have epilepsy, with pleasing personality and good oral communication skills.
